Transaction c57add80d987a941c3287c18cc13d4e9cb55cb162fbaac6c445640102821ef36

2 Input
2 Outputs
  • c57add80d987a941c3287c18cc13d4e9cb55cb162fbaac6c445640102821ef36:0
  • value  74114739
    address  17fqPX32Qy4wSF9jUZHBsNxfU5cgXEaTqB
  • c57add80d987a941c3287c18cc13d4e9cb55cb162fbaac6c445640102821ef36:1
  • value  28874061
    address  3CXghDcXAMgpQ4otxaUuXC2oP6qK1xPgAT